If you have an in home office you should be able to estimate a portion of the total expense as a business expense. I.e. total square feet of home = 2000, approx. office space 500 sq feet, therefore you could write off 1/4 or $75 as a business expense.
(that is the way it works in Canada, I'm pretty sure US tax laws are similar.)

This would go for other home expenses as well, i.e. interest on your mortgage, utilities, insurance, etc.
